All :L
10장 프로그래밍 언어 활용 (데이터 입출력) 본문
반응형
[데이터 입출력]
💡 데이터 입출력 개요
▶️ 데이터 입출력
: 데이터 입출력은 키보드로부터 데이터를 입력받아 화면이나 파일로 출력하는 것
▶️ C언어의 입출력 함수
- 입력 함수 : scanf
- 출력 함수 : printf
▶️ Java언어의 입출력 함수
- 입력 함수 : Scanner, nextInt
- 출력 함수 : print, printf, println
💡 프로그램 코드 읽고 해석하기
▶️ 헝가리안 표기법
: 변수의 자료형을 알 수 있도록 자료형을 의미하는 문자를 포함해 변수를 작성하는 방법
ex)
i_InputA, i_InputB, i_Result
▶️ 자료형
- 정수형 : int
- 문자형 : char
- 실수형 : float, double
▶️ 서식지정 & 제어문자
[서식 문자열]
- %d : 10진수 정수
- %o : 8진수 정수
- %x : 16진수 정수
- %c : 문자
- %s : 문자열
- %f : 실수
[제어문자]
- \n : 커서를 다음 줄의 처음으로 이동
- \t : 커서를 일정 간격 띄움
- \0 : NULL 문자 출력
▶️ 연산자 & 우선순위
[단항 연산자]
- ! ~ ++ -- sizeof
[이항 연산자]
- 산술 연산자
- / * %
- .+ -
- 시프트 연산자
- << >>
- 관계 연산자
- < <= >= >
- == !=
- 비트 연산자
- &
- ^
- |
- 논리 연산자
- &&
- ||
[삼항 연산자]
- 조건 연산자
- ? :
[대입 연산자]
- ? :
- = += -= *= /= %= <<= >>=
[순서 연산자]
- .
반응형
'STUDY > 정보처리기사' 카테고리의 다른 글
11장 응용 SW 기초 기술 활용 (운영체제의 개념) (0) | 2023.04.22 |
---|---|
9장 소프트웨어 개발 보안 구축 (보안 솔루션) (0) | 2023.04.17 |
9장 소프트웨어 개발 보안 구축 (서비스 공격 유형 (2/3)) (0) | 2023.04.17 |
9장 소프트웨어 개발 보안 구축 (서비스 공격 유형 (1/3)) (0) | 2023.04.17 |
9장 소프트웨어 개발 보안 구축 (암호 알고리즘) (0) | 2023.04.16 |
Comments